Gallus Screeny: the screen printing plate for maximum printing quality

Success depends on the printing plate. The Gallus Screeny printing plates for rotary screen printing forms are an in-house development by Gallus. The unique microstructure, stabilised fabric and perfect structural balance of photosensitive coating ensure maximum printing quality and consistency - for extremely fine lines, solids and relief printing. The design of the Screeny printing plate permits an optimum ink flow - for the fastest high-quality screen printing ever.

As a result of the continuous development work Gallus has the most extensive product range on the market and offers its customers a wide range of solutions for almost every screen printing application.

S-Line Digital

The Screeny digital screen printing plates are provided with an ablation layer (LAMS layer), which is applied to the photopolymer.

Gallus Screen Rings NT

Made of a special, light but upmost strong metal alloy, the improved Gallus Screen rings perform longer and better than ever before. Thanks to a unique manufacturing process, the modified surface structure guarantees highest adhesion between mesh and Screen ring, but is also easy to remove afterwards. printing.
